Lunacid: Tears of the Moon is now available for free on Steam. It’s a Lunacid spin-off made with the Sword of Moonlight — a toolkit from 2000 used to create King’s Field like games that was released by FROMSOFT. After all, a lot of inspiration for the original Lunacid stems from my deep appreciation of Shadow Tower and King’s Field games.
Tears of the Moon is also a dark fantasy dungeon crawler — full of daunting foes, spells and weapons to obtain and, of course, secrets to discover. The game is very much worth trying out, if you never got to experience the KF series, or feel nostalgic about games of that era.
Naturally, a tool straight from the year 2000 is bound to have a fair share of limitations. However, I very much enjoyed challenging myself to be more creative within these constraints. And I hope, that you could appreciate both this passion and FROMSOFT’s legacy in Lunacid: Tears of the Moon.

2.1.4 Patch notes:
Fixed Polish font atlas. Fixed Legacy mode controls to be more like the Sword of Moonlight engine controls. Numpad now can control movement and looking, left shift and control attacks and blocks. For the controller, the right thumbstick now strafes and looks up and down.

Thanks to the guiding Moonlight, our prowess and a certain amount of luck — Steam Trading cards for Lunacid are finally available.
The idea with these was to tie each of the characters to a certain Major Arcana card, but the choices here aren’t exactly ‘canon’. So it’s best to treat them for what they are — a cool art piece expanding the game. Speaking of! Definitely check out the full versions of the cards, because the small portrait is just a preview.
Of course, Trading cards also mean profile backgrounds and emojis. We won’t spoil the surprise here, but the backgrounds were drawn exclusively for Trading Cards by the same artist as the cards themselves, and the emojis are done by Akuma Kira.
